Abstract
The crystal structure and ordering of Nb 5+ doped high Tc compounds has been identified by XRD and TEM. As examples, we have studied Ba2Y1Cu2.6Nb0.4O9−z and Ba2Y1Cu2.5Nb0.5O9−z , which consist of -two main phases, respectively. A face-centered cubic superlattice perovskite structure with a=8.4513 (Å) is common phase to both samples. In this phase, Y, Nb, and Cu are on B-sites with ordered Y and Nb in direction. However, the second phase is different in these two samples. One contains a well-known ordered Ba-Y-Ba structure on A-sites as an orthorhombic perovskite superstructure, but another sample contains disordered Ba and Y on A-sites as a tetragonal perovskite structure with a=b=3.8667 (Å) and c=3.9429 (Å).
